India's Tax Amendment Bill Aims to Boost FDI, Jobs and Digital Payments

India has introduced a new Tax Amendment Bill designed to attract greater foreign direct investment and stimulate economic activity. The legislation targets key areas including employment generation and the digital payments ecosystem, particularly UPI. Experts analyzing the bill say its provisions reflect a clear policy intent to draw global capital and businesses into the country. The amendments are seen as part of a broader government strategy to position India as a more investment-friendly destination.
